Senior Software Architect
3 weeks ago
Halma is a global group of life-saving technologies companies, driven by a clear purpose. We are an FTSE 100 company with headquarters in the UK and operations in 23 countries, including regional hubs in India, China, Brazil, and the US.
Our diverse group of nearly 50 global companies specialize in market leading technologies that push the boundaries of science and technology.
For the last 42 years, the combination of our purpose, strategy, people, DNA and sustainable business model has resulted in record long-term growth in revenues and profits and an increase in dividend by ≥ 5% every year– an achievement unrivalled by any company listed on the London Stock Exchange.
We have a team of over 250 professionals representing commercial, digital and support functions across our seven offices in India, two in Bengaluru and one each in Delhi, Mumbai, Thanjavur, Ahmedabad and Vadodara.
Why join us?
We offer a safe and respectful workplace, where everyone can be who they 'REALLY' are, feel free to bring their whole selves to work and use their unique talents, knowledge, expertise, experiences, and backgrounds to create meaningful outcomes.
We nurture entrepreneurial spirits and empower them to think beyond the possibilities, to discover, shape and build their own unique stories. We promote and support non-linear career growth for the right talent.
We are simple, humble and approachable, and we believe in leadership at all levels to bring our purpose to life. Everyone at Halma India makes an impact, and so do you when you join us
About Halma Company CenTrak
CenTrak brings high quality, reliable and affordable real-time location technology to healthcare. Company helps healthcare facilities create a safe and efficient healthcare environment through the deployment of the industry's leading real-time location system (RTLS). More than a hospital tracking system – CenTrak provide actionable location and environmental condition data across the entire healthcare enterprise.
The company's head office is in Pennsylvania, USA, with a regional office in Belgium.
URL: https://centrak.com/
Roles & Responsibilities
- Lead the architecture, design, and development of SaaS-based cloud applications using C# .NET, Nest.JS, and Angular.
- Design and implement event-based microservice architectures on AWS, ensuring high scalability and reliability.
- Apply Domain-Driven Design (DDD) and operational design principles to build robust and maintainable systems.
- Utilize Test-Driven Development (TDD) and Behavior-Driven Development (BDD) methodologies to ensure high-quality software delivery.
- Create and document high-level and low-level designs for software architecture.
- Ensure application security by implementing best practices and conducting regular security audits.
- Optimize application performance to ensure efficient and responsive user experiences.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Mentor and guide junior developers, fostering a culture of continuous learning and improvement.
- Conduct code reviews, ensuring adherence to best practices and coding standards.
- Work on all tiers of the application, including frontend, backend, and middleware.
- Optimize SQL and NoSQL databases for performance, scalability, and reliability.
- Stay updated with emerging technologies and industry trends to drive innovation within the organization.
Experience
- 12+ years of experience in software development, with a focus on SaaS-based cloud applications.
Critical Success Factors
- Expertise in .NET, Nest.JS, and Angular frameworks.
- Proven experience in designing and implementing event-based microservice architectures using AWS.
- Strong knowledge of Domain-Driven Design (DDD) and operational design principles.
- Hands-on experience across all application tiers: frontend, backend, and middleware.
- Proficiency in SQL and NoSQL databases.
- Excellent problem-solving skills and the ability to work in a fast-paced environment.
- Strong communication and leadership skills.
- Experience with DevOps practices and tools.
- Knowledge of containerization technologies such as Docker and Kubernetes.
- Familiarity with CI/CD pipelines and automated testing frameworks.
- Experience with Agile/Scrum methodologies.
Academic Qualification
- Bachelor's or master's degree in computer science, Engineering, or a related field.
-
Junior Architect
1 week ago
Bengaluru, Karnataka, India AHAMASMI ARCHITECT Full timeJob DescriptionCompany DescriptionAhamasmi Architect - A specialized Architectural Design and Revit Professional&aposs CompanyRole DescriptionThis is a full-time on-site role for a Junior Architect at AHAMASMI ARCHITECT located in Bengaluru. The Junior Architect will be responsible for assisting in architectural design, project planning, and development of...
-
Senior Java Software Architect
3 days ago
Bengaluru, Karnataka, India Guidewire Software Full timeAbout the RoleWe are seeking a seasoned Java software architect to lead our development team in designing and implementing complex, scalable software systems for Guidewire Cloud, our next-generation, cloud-native Insurance Platform. As a key member of our agile development teams, you will work closely with product managers, UX/UI designers, and other...
-
Senior Software Architect
7 days ago
Bengaluru, Karnataka, India Siemens Healthineers Full timeSiemens Healthineers is seeking a Senior Software Architect to lead the design, development, and implementation of software applications and systems using the Microsoft technology stack. The ideal candidate will have a strong background in software development and architecture, with a focus on the Microsoft technology stack.The selected candidate will be...
-
Senior Software Architect
2 weeks ago
Bengaluru, Karnataka, India Philips Full timeJOB DESCRIPTION Job Title Senior Software Architect - C++ Job Description Job title: Senior Software Architect Your role: Duties and Responsibilities: Responsible for the design, implementation, integration, and testing of enterprise backend components or modules in high quality, according to requirements, and on time. Comply and align...
-
Senior Software Architect
3 weeks ago
Bengaluru, Karnataka, India Squareroot Consulting Pvt Ltd Full timeHiring Software Architect or Senior Architect for multiple Large Scale Product Companies for Research & Innovation Team.Position : Senior/Software Architect Location : Bangalore, IndiaExperience : 12 to 17 YrsEducation : are looking for : - 12+ years of experience in Building Large Scale Distributed Systems- Hands on in Architecture and developing large...
-
Senior Software Architect
7 days ago
Bengaluru, Karnataka, India RUCKUS Networks Full timeRUCKUS Networks seeks a skilled Senior Software Architect to lead the design and development of complex features and system components. As a Staff Software Engineer, you will provide technical leadership and mentorship to engineering teams.You will work with a dynamic and focused team to develop state-of-the-art Wi-Fi and IoT applications. This is an...
-
Senior Software Architect
6 days ago
Bengaluru, Karnataka, India Dell Full timeJob OverviewWe are seeking a highly skilled Senior Software Architect to join our CTO Storage team. This role will be responsible for designing and developing innovative storage solutions that meet the evolving needs of our customers.Key ResponsibilitiesLead the design and development of storage architecture for data path technologies across our...
-
Network Architect
1 week ago
Bengaluru, Karnataka, India Spigot Software Full timeRole profile : Self-starting, passionate and intellectually curious Technical Design Authority to join global Storage team. Focus on designing, delivering solutions for dynamic environment with differing scenarios and requirements. Position : Senior Network Automation Architect our client are building industry leading in house software to create application...
-
Senior Software Architect
2 days ago
Bengaluru, Karnataka, India Pramana Full timePramana is hiring a highly skilled Senior Software Architect to drive the development of our web applications and services.Job Description:Design and Develop Scalable Web ApplicationsCollaborate with Cross-Functional TeamsImplement and Maintain APIsWrite Efficient and Reliable CodeTroubleshoot and Debug Complex IssuesThe ideal candidate will have 3-5 years...
-
Senior Software Architect
5 days ago
Bengaluru, Karnataka, India Zallery Full timeAbout ZalleryZallery is a leading technology firm that utilizes cutting-edge software solutions to drive innovation. Our team of experts collaborates to design, develop, and implement web-based applications that cater to the diverse needs of our clients.We are seeking a skilled Senior Software Architect to join our development team. As a key member, you will...
-
Senior PHP Software Architect
6 days ago
Bengaluru, Karnataka, India Jigya Software Services Full timeJob OverviewWe are seeking an experienced Senior PHP Developer to join our team at Jigya Software Services.This is a great opportunity for a skilled developer who wants to take on new challenges and contribute to the development of innovative applications using Symfony 5.x+, PHP 8.x, and other cutting-edge technologies.In this role, you will be responsible...
-
Senior Software Architect
7 days ago
Bengaluru, Karnataka, India BXP SUPPORT AND SOLUTIONS PVT LTD Full timeJob DescriptionWe are seeking a highly skilled Senior Software Architect to join our team at BXP SUPPORT AND SOLUTIONS PVT LTD. As a key member of our development team, you will be responsible for designing and implementing software solutions that meet the needs of our clients.Key Responsibilities:Work with development teams and product managers to create...
-
Senior Node.js Software Architect
4 days ago
Bengaluru, Karnataka, India Gammastack Full time**Gammastack Overview:**We are a cutting-edge technology company looking for a skilled Senior Node.js Software Architect to lead our development efforts. Our ideal candidate will have a proven track record of designing and implementing scalable, high-performance server-side systems using Node.js.**Key Responsibilities:Design, develop, and implement complex...
-
Senior Software Architect
1 day ago
Bengaluru, Karnataka, India Artificial Intelligence Global Company Full timeJob Overview: As a senior software architect at Artificial Intelligence Global Company, you will play a key role in designing and developing scalable web applications using front- and back-end technologies. With a strong background in full-stack development, you will lead the development of robust back-end services and APIs, design and manage relational and...
-
Senior Embedded Software Architect
6 days ago
Bengaluru, Karnataka, India HME Full timeAbout the Role:We are seeking a highly skilled Senior Embedded Software Architect to join our team at HME. As a key member of our software development team, you will be responsible for designing and developing firmware and software applications for our product line.Key Responsibilities:Design and develop firmware for embedded systems and software intended...
-
Senior Distributed Systems Software Architect
7 hours ago
Bengaluru, Karnataka, India GE HealthCare Full timeAt GE Healthcare, we are committed to harnessing the power of technology to make healthcare more precise, more personalized, and more accessible for everyone. As a Senior Distributed Systems Software Architect, you will work closely with architects and technical product managers to translate overall system architecture and product requirements into...
-
Senior Software Architect Position
4 hours ago
Bengaluru, Karnataka, India SonicWall Full timeWe are seeking a highly skilled Full-Stack Developer to join our QA engineering team at SonicWall. As a key member of our team, you will be responsible for designing and architecting software systems, ensuring scalability, maintainability, and performance.Job DescriptionThis is a senior-level position that requires 6+ years of experience in full-stack...
-
Senior Software Architect
1 week ago
Bengaluru, Karnataka, India Snaphunt Pte Ltd Full timeThe Job : We are looking for a Senior Software Architect with solid Node JS experience to design and implement scalable, high-performance, and reliable backend systems for our company. The ideal candidate will be responsible for leading the technical design and development of our backend services, working closely with cross-functional teams including...
-
Senior Software Architect Firmware
7 days ago
Bengaluru, Karnataka, India Dell Full timeJob DescriptionWe are seeking a highly skilled Senior Software Architect Firmware to join our team. In this role, you will be responsible for designing and developing sophisticated systems and software based on customer business goals, needs, and general business environment.Your Key Responsibilities:Contribute to the design and architecture of high-quality,...
-
Senior Software Architect
7 days ago
Bengaluru, Karnataka, India Hirelo Full time**Job Description:**We are seeking a talented Senior Software Architect to lead our frontend development efforts. As a key member of the Hirelo team, you will be responsible for designing and implementing scalable, high-performance web applications using modern front-end technologies.**Responsibilities:Lead projects that span our stack, including Go and Java...